High-Stakes Battle of Blockbusters: Gadar 2, OMG 2, and Bhola Shankar Simultaneous Release

The clash of these powerhouse superstars has generated sky-high expectations among audiences.

  • Maheswara Rao Nadella | Updated On - August 10, 2023 / 02:27 PM IST

Movie enthusiasts are in for a thrilling cinematic showdown this weekend as three highly anticipated films – “Gadar 2,” “OMG 2,” and “Bhola Shankar” – prepare to hit the screens simultaneously. The clash of these powerhouse superstars has generated sky-high expectations among audiences.

The pre-release buzz around “Gadar 2” has been electric, with the film already making waves even before its premiere. Reports reveal that the movie has secured a staggering 1.3 lakh ticket sales for its opening day, with projections indicating a surge to 2 lahks by Thursday’s end. Leading ticketing platform BookMyShow reports an impressive 3 lakh tickets sold so far, with cities like Delhi-NCR, Mumbai, Jaipur, Patna, Pune, Ahmedabad, Bengaluru, and Surat leading in sales. Film analyst Taran Adarsh predicts a formidable opening day figure of over Rs 35 crore, particularly highlighting the robust performance in mass circuits. As a sequel to the 2001 blockbuster “Gadar: Ek Prem Katha,” “Gadar 2” is directed by Anil Sharma and boasts a star-studded cast including Sunny Deol, Ameesha Patel, Utkarsh Sharma, and Simrat Kaur.

In contrast, “OMG 2,” also known as “Oh My God 2,” is taking a subtler approach to promotions. The film has already clocked 45,000 ticket sales on BookMyShow. Film expert Girish Johar projects an opening day collection of 8 to 10 crore, noting that the makers are adopting a cautious strategy. Johar explains, “They are not trying to over-commit. They are not going overboard as they know what the content is, and they know they cannot target the family audience because they have got an ‘A’ certificate.” Directed by Amit Rai, “OMG 2” stars Akshay Kumar, Pankaj Tripathi, and Yami Gautam.

Meanwhile, “Bhola Shankar,” starring Chiranjeevi, is off to a promising start with bookings crossing Rs 6 crore globally. While initial sales may trail behind Rajinikanth’s “Jailer,” which premiered on August 10, optimism surrounds “Bhola Shankar” as it approaches its release. Early signs indicate strong ticket sales in Hindi-speaking regions. Directed by Meher Ramesh, the film features an ensemble cast including Tamannaah Bhatia, Keerthy Suresh, Sushanth, and Chiranjeevi in the titular role.
